I mounted the mesh with some epoxy, I just traced the plate cover outline on it with a sharpie(thick tip) and cut out 1 inch wider than the out line. I then molded it around the back of the opening, you will have to cut diagonal cuts in the mesh at the corners so it forms evenly around the opening. Take it out again, bend it down a lil tighter and then mount it again and put the epoxy around on the top sides and bottom, use as much as you think it will need. I made sure it had enough to cover the mesh without the mesh "popping through it" It's a pain but worth it. Patience is your friend doing this. Make sure the epoxy is getting thick before doing this as it will just slop out everywhere
